Hello, everyone.  Today's scripture-writing journal page features Luke 1:26-33, which describes the angel Gabriel's announcement to the Virgin Mary that she would conceive and give birth to a son named Jesus, who would be great, called the Son of the Most High, and reign forever. The angel explains that he was sent from God to Nazareth to a virgin betrothed to Joseph of the house of David.
